Officialisation of Linked Data Working Group
Linked Data Working Group >
The Linked Data Working Group is responsible for building and maintaining a recommended version of an
ifcOWL ontology as an equivalent to the IFC EXPRESS schema. The ifcOWL ontology is to be used in linked
data and semantic web applications that consume IFC data.
Fit in BuildingSMART activities
Purpose:
Bring together experts in BIM and Web of Data technologies to define existing and future
use cases and requirements for linked data based applications across the building life cycle.
